Warehouse associates are the foundation of our company’s success. As a Forklift Operator (Non‑Formula), you will operate material handling equipment such as forklift, pallet jack, reach truck, etc., and maintain the efficient flow of products through our distribution process while ensuring all safety, GMP and quality standards are met.
Responsibilities- Locate proper storage slot on racks, set pallets in place with forklift or hand stack items, enter product data and location into appropriate unit.
- Count‑check incoming freight, transport to freezer with forklift/pallet jack.
- Replenish pick slots with outgoing stock items according to next‑day work orders; rotate date‑sensitive stock to front of rack and remove outdated inventory.
- Disperse over‑stocked items to available slots for temporary storage.
- Remove empty pallets, cardboard packing, and strapping to appropriate receptacles.
- Inspect empty pallets for damage, stack and move pallets with pallet jack or forklift to proper storage area.
- Follow all preferred work methods, safety policies and procedures per company guidelines.
- Ensure work area is safe and report any unsafe conditions or acts immediately.
- Review work schedule, perform safety check on equipment, obtain supplies required to perform the work and prepare for operations.
- Wear all required Personal Protective Equipment and Safety Gear.
- Achieve required productivity and accuracy standards per location and company guidelines.
- Work from receiving sheets, computer print‑out, established procedures and practices, written and/or verbal instructions.
- Inspect items for damage, perform temperature and quality checks and take appropriate action as needed.
- Perform general housekeeping duties in work area as needed.
- Replace recharging batteries and complete vehicle inspection checklist.
- Secure all equipment and complete all necessary paperwork at the end of the shift.
- Perform other related duties as assigned.
